SACO — A Falmouth woman was killed early today after the car she was riding in rolled over on an exit ramp of the Maine Turnpike in Saco.
State police trooper Lee Vanadestine identified the victim as Leisha Tarbox, 27. The driver, Scott Daniels, 28, of Hollis, was arrested on a charge of drunken driving. He suffered minor injuries.
Vanadestine said Daniels was travelling northbound on the Maine Turnpike, but was going too fast when his 1991 VW Jetta tried to enter the ramp. Tarbox was ejected from the car.
Daniels is being held tonight at the York County Jail on $10,000 bail.
The accident was reported at 1:50 a.m. today.
